In a general setting, oversubscription in planning can be posed as: given a set of goals, each one with a utility, obtain a plan that achieves some (or all) the goals, maximizing the utility, as well as minimizing the cost of achieving those goals. In this paper, we present an application domain, automatic generation of e-learning courses design, that shows a variation of the oversubscription problem. Here, there is only one goal: generating a course design for a given student. However, in order to achieve the goal, the course design can include or not different kinds of activities, each one with a utility and cost. Furthermore, these activities are grouped into clusters, so that at least one of the activities in each cluster is needed, though many more can be used. Finally, these problems also have an overall cost threshold (usually in terms of student time).
